Killer

Summary

Killer is a single[1].

Key Facts

  • Killer received the platinum record[2].
  • Killer's instance of is recorded as single[3].
  • Killer's genre is electropop[4].
  • Killer's genre is pop rap[5].
  • Killer's genre is dance-pop[6].
  • Killer followed Sparami[7].
  • Killer followed L'amore è una cosa semplice[8].
  • Killer was followed by Non cambierò mai[9].
  • Killer was followed by La fine[10].
  • Killer was produced by Tiziano Ferro[11].
  • Killer was produced by Michele Canova[12].
  • Killer was performed by Baby K[13].
  • Killer was performed by Tiziano Ferro[14].
  • Killer's record label is recorded as EMI[15].
  • Killer's country of origin is recorded as Italy[16].
  • Killer was published on January 25, 2013[17].
  • Killer's single taken from the album or EP is recorded as Una seria[18].
